AP US History - US Presidents Flashcards

9809361920George Washington1789-1797 Federalist Whiskey Rebellion; Judiciary Act; Neutrality; Farewell Address0
9809361921John Adams1797-1801 Federalist XYZ Affair; Alien and Sedition Acts1
9809361922Thomas Jefferson1801-1809 Democratic-Republican Marbury v. Madison; Louisiana Purchase; Embargo of 18072
9809361923James Madison1809-1817 Democratic-Republican War of 1812; First Protective Tariff3
9809361924James Monroe1817-1825 Democratic-Republican Missouri Compromise of 1820; Monroe Doctrine4
9809361925John Quincy Adams1825-1829 Democratic-Republican "Corrupt Bargain"; "Tariff of Abominations"5
9809361926Andrew Jackson1829-1837 Democrat Nullification Crisis; Bank War; Indian Removal Act6
9809361927Martin Van Buren1837-1841 Democrat Trail of Tears; Specie Circular; Panic of 18377
9809361928William Henry Harrison1841 Whig "Tippecanoe and Tyler too!"; First Whig President8
9809361929John Tyler1841-1845 Whig "His Accidency"; Webster-Ashburton Treaty9
9809361930James Polk1845-1849 Democrat Texas annexation; Mexican War10
9809361931Zachary Taylor1849-1850 Whig Mexican War hero and staunch Unionist11
9809361932Millard Fillmore1850-1853 Whig Compromise of 185012
9809361933Franklin Pierce1853-1857 Democrat Kansas-Nebraska Act; Gadsden Purchase13
9809361934James Buchanan1857-1861 Democrat Dred Scott decision; Harpers Ferry raid14
9809361935Abraham Lincoln1861-1865 Republican Secession and Civil War; Emancipation Proclamation15
9809361936Andrew Johnson1865-1869 Democrat 13th and 14th amendments; Radical Reconstruction; Impeachment16
9809361937Ulysses Grant1869-1877 Republican 15th amendment; Panic of 187317
9809361938Rutherford Hayes1877-1881 Republican Compromise of 1877; labor unions and strikes18
9809361939James Garfield1881, Republican Brief resurgence of presidential authority; Increase in American naval power; Purge corruption in the Post Office19
9809361940Chester Arthur1881-1885 Republican Standard Oil trust created Edison lights up New York City20
9809361941Grover Cleveland1885-1889 (1st term), 1893-1897 (2nd term) Democrat Interstate Commerce Act; Dawes Act; Panic of 1893; Pullman Strike21
9809361942Benjamin Harrison1889-1893 Republican Sherman Anti-Trust Act; Closure of the frontier22
9809361943William McKinley1897-1901 Republican Spanish-American War; Open Door policy23
9809361944Theodore Roosevelt1901-1909 Republican Progressivism; Square Deal; Big Stick Diplomacy24
9809361945William Howard Taft1909-1913 Republican Dollar diplomacy NAACP founded25
9809361946Woodrow Wilson1913-1921 Democrat WWI; League of Nations; 18th and 19th amendments; Segregation of federal offices; First Red Scare26
9809361947Warren Harding1921-1923 Republican "Return to normalcy", return to isolationism; Tea Pot Dome scandal; Prohibition27
9809361948Calvin Coolidge1923-1929 Republican Small-government (laissez-faire) conservative28
9809361949Herbert Hoover1929-1933 Republican "American individualism"; Stock Market Crash; Dust Bowl; Hawley-Smoot Tariff29
9809361950Franklin Delano Roosevelt1933-1945 Democrat New Deal; WWII; Japanese Internment; "Fireside Chats"30
9809361951Harry Truman1945-1953 Democrat A-bomb; Marshall Plan; Korean War; United Nations31
9809361952Dwight Eisenhower1953-1961 Republican Brown v. Board of Education; Second Red Scare; Highway Act and suburbanization ("white flight"); Farewell Address warning of the military industrial complex32
9809361953John Kennedy1961-1963 Democrat Camelot; Bay of Pigs; Cuban Missile Crisis; Space program; Peace Corps33
9809361954Lyndon Johnson1963-1969 Democrat Civil and Voting Rights acts; Gulf of Tonkin Resolution; Great Society34
9809361955Richard Nixon1969-1974 Republican Environmental Protection Act; China visit; Moon Landing; Watergate35
9809361956Gerald Ford1974-1977 Republican Pardoning of Nixon; OPEC crisis36
9809361957Jimmy Carter1977-1981 Democrat stagflation / energy crisis; Iran hostage crisis; Camp David Accords37
9809361958Ronald Reagan1981-1989 Republican Conservative revolution; Iran-Contra scandal38
9809361959George H. W. Bush1989-1993 Republican Persian Gulf War39
9809361960Bill Clinton1993-2001 Democrat NAFTA; Lewinsky scandal and impreachment40
9809361961George W. Bush2001-2008 Republican War on terrorism; Patriot Act; Tax cuts; "No Child Left Behind"41
9809361962Barack Obama2008-2017 Democrat Affordable Care Act42
9809361963Donald Trump2017-? Republican "Make America Great Again"43
